Chief of Staff to the Chief Operating Officer (COO)About the CompanyPopular e-wallet for bitcoin exchange & storageIndustryInternetTypePublic CompanyFounded2012Employees1001-5000CategoriesBitcoinE-CommercePersonal FinanceCryptocurrencyFinTechTechnologyInformation Technology & ServicesInternetMobile PaymentsPaymentsVirtual CurrencyeCommerceBlock ChainTrading PlatformSpecialtiesdigital currencysoftwarepayment processingbitcointechnologyapicryptographybitcoin exchangedigital currency exchangevirtual currencyfintechethereumetherand blockchainBusiness ClassificationsE-CommerceAbout the RoleThe Company is in search of a Chief of Staff to the Chief Operating Officer (COO) to join their dynamic team. The successful candidate will be a key player in the organization, acting as a force multiplier for the COO and ensuring that the company's priorities are advanced. This role demands a high level of commitment and the ability to operate in a fast-paced, high-growth environment. The Chief of Staff will lead critical initiatives, manage special projects, and orchestrate the COO's responsibilities to maximize her effectiveness. The ideal candidate will have a BA/BS degree or equivalent practical experience, with a minimum of 4 years in management consulting, business operations, strategy, or a product role at a high-growth technology company. Strong analytical, problem-solving, and interpersonal skills are essential, as is a proven track record of exceptional communication. Applicants for the Chief of Staff position at the company should be prepared to be challenged and to work alongside some of the best in the industry. The role requires a proactive approach to problem-solving, the ability to anticipate and address issues before they reach the COO, and a talent for developing compelling content and narratives for both internal and external audiences. The company values individuals who are passionate about its mission and the potential of technology to drive change. While not mandatory, entrepreneurial experience and a demonstrated interest in the industry are considered advantageous. The work culture is intense and demanding, but for those who thrive in such an environment and are eager to make a significant impact, it is a truly rewarding opportunity.Hiring Manager TitleChief Operating Officer (COO)Travel PercentLess than 10%FunctionsOperationsStrategy
